Deputy Catering Manager
All potential applicants are encouraged to scroll through and read the complete job description before applying.
Education Sector | South East London
Salary: £42,000- £44,000
5 days out of 7 – mainly Monday to Friday with occasional weekend
An exciting opportunity has arisen for an experienced and motivated Deputy Catering Manager to join one of the UK's most prestigious colleges.
Based within an impressive boarding school environment, this role offers the opportunity to join a busy in-house catering operation and play a key role in delivering exceptional food service standards across the site.
Our client is seeking a passionate, hands-on catering professional with ambition, energy, and a positive “can-do” attitude. This is an excellent opportunity for someone who thrives in a fast-paced environment, enjoys leading teams, and is committed to delivering outstanding operational standards.
The Role
As Deputy Head of Catering, you will support the management of a busy and diverse catering operation, overseeing daily service delivery, team performance, and operational excellence.
Managing and supporting a catering team of 40+ staff members
Supervising and working closely with 4 Heads of Department
Leading staff training, development, and performance management
Supporting financial reporting and budget control.
Managing purchasing and stock control.
Maintaining high standards of food safety, health & safety, and risk assessments.
Driving exceptional customer service and presentation standards throughout the operation. xwzovoh
Lead by example, inspire your team, and help create a positive working culture that encourages both employee engagement and improvement.
About You
Previous management experience within the education & contract catering sector
A strong background in high-volume catering operations
Excellent leadership and team management skills
A proactive, hands-on approach with strong attention to detail
Strong communication and organisational skills
A calm, resilient, and solution-focused approach under pressure
A genuine passion for food, hospitality, and customer service
Good knowledge of food safety, health & safety, and compliance procedures
A full UK driving licence
